Rathmullan footpath repairs on the way

JUST over €50,000 had been allocated for footpath repairs in Rathmullan.

The news has been welcomed by Cllr. Pauric McGarvey who had tabled a motion at last week’s meeting of Letterkenny-Milford Municipal District Council saying that there was an “urgent need” for the repair and upgrading of many footpaths in the town.

He said that there are a lot of elderly people using a lot of paths that are not fit for purpose.

Advertisement

An official reply confirmed the allocation and stated that the works “are programmed to be carried out in the near future”.

Cllr. Liam Blaney commented that if there is a lack of staffing for works, they should consider getting in private contractors.

Meanwhile, Cllr. McGarvey noted that the recently introduced one-way system in the seaside resort is working very well.
